Accéder directement au contenu Accéder directement à la navigation
Communication dans un congrès

Par4All: From Convex Array Regions to Heterogeneous Computing

Abstract : Recent compilers comprise an incremental way for converting software toward accelerators. For instance, the pgi Accelerator [14] or hmpp [3] require the use of directives. The programmer must select the pieces of source that are to be executed on the accelerator, providing optional directives that act as hints for data allocations and transfers. The compiler generates all code automatically. [...] Unlike these approaches, Par4All [13] is an automatic parallelizing and optimizing compiler for C and Fortran sequential programs funded by the hpc Project startup. The purpose of this source-to-source compiler is to integrate several compilation tools into an easy-to-use yet powerful compiler that automatically transforms existing programs to target various hardware platforms.
Type de document :
Communication dans un congrès
Liste complète des métadonnées

Littérature citée [14 références]  Voir  Masquer  Télécharger

https://hal-mines-paristech.archives-ouvertes.fr/hal-00744733
Contributeur : Claire Medrala <>
Soumis le : vendredi 2 novembre 2012 - 14:35:32
Dernière modification le : mercredi 14 octobre 2020 - 03:52:19
Archivage à long terme le : : dimanche 3 février 2013 - 02:35:09

Fichiers

Identifiants

  • HAL Id : hal-00744733, version 1

Citation

Mehdi Amini, Béatrice Creusillet, Stéphanie Even, Ronan Keryell, Onig Goubier, et al.. Par4All: From Convex Array Regions to Heterogeneous Computing. IMPACT 2012 : Second International Workshop on Polyhedral Compilation Techniques HiPEAC 2012, Jan 2012, Paris, France. ⟨hal-00744733⟩

Partager

Métriques

Consultations de la notice

782

Téléchargements de fichiers

621